Basically south of Outwest Campground. Hit lunch area from jamboree. Find trail heading south. If you have a gps it shows Swan lake. Trail is not bad at all.

As dooing said be careful as some areas around swan are a Provincial Park and you will pay fines..

Swan Lake is easy to find from the pipeline that runs to Ram gasplant, From Southfork head S.W. on the pipeline, when you get to the valley with the overhead powerline head south on the trail.

The Stelfork Family ranch has built fences in the area so it may be blocked off in some places.

the cross fencing on the power line and other area's isn't the Stelfox's........ Mr Stelfox only blocked off SouthFork Road and the trail that ran on the southern edge of his property. The rest was done by a different family that has the grazing leases for all of that land. They are tired of the irresponsible campers and quadders leaving gates open, leaving trash around, dumping their tanks etc. They also had one of their cow shot this year, they've had enough of it, and truthfully I cannot blame them.
